Abstract

The invention discloses a light sectional fabricated construction waste transportation and collection channel, including a plurality of groups of transporting pipes and masonry dustbin rooms. Each group of transporting pipes includes an upper prefabricated pipeline, a middle prefabricated pipeline and a lower prefabricated pipeline successively connected from top to bottom, the side faces of the lower prefabricated pipelines are provided with waste mouths, heights of each group of transporting pipes are the same as that of a floor, the transporting pipes are fixed on the outer side of the outer wall of a building through connecting devices, the lower ends of the transporting pipes are connected with entrances of the masonry dustbin rooms, the masonry waste rooms are internally provided with buffer ramps, and the lowest sides of the buffer ramps are provided with electric rolling gates. According to the light sectional fabricated construction waste transportation and collection channel,the structure is novel, the weight is light, mounting and dismounting can be conducted by one to two persons, and safety and efficiency are achieved. In addition, the pipelines have the advantages that the pipelines can be recycled, environmental protection is achieved, transportation efficiency of construction waste is improved, and dust pollution is reduced. The floor construction waste vertical transportation channel is simple and practical, and can be fully used for reference in similar projects in the future.

Description

technical field [0001] The invention belongs to the field of construction waste transportation, and in particular relates to a light segmented assembled construction waste transportation collection channel. Background technique [0002] On the construction site, the traditional transportation methods of construction waste mainly include hoisting transportation, construction elevator transportation and garbage channel transportation. For hoisting transportation, this transportation method is not only time-consuming and laborious, but also prone to falling objects, which will cause casualties and property losses. For the transportation of construction elevators, it must first be transported to the construction elevator by trolley or manually. This transportation method is very inefficient and has many potential safety hazards.
